ENTRY EC 2.7.1.40
NAME Pyruvate kinase
Phosphoenolpyruvate kinase
Phosphoenol transphosphorylase
CLASS Transferases
Transferring phosphorus-containing groups
Phosphotransferases with an alcohol group as acceptor
SYSNAME ATP:pyruvate O2-phosphotransferase
REACTION ATP + Pyruvate = ADP + Phosphoenolpyruvate;
UTP + Pyruvate = UDP + Phosphoenolpyruvate;
GTP + Pyruvate = GDP + Phosphoenolpyruvate;
CTP + Pyruvate = CDP + Phosphoenolpyruvate;
ITP + Pyruvate = IDP + Phosphoenolpyruvate;
dATP + Pyruvate = dADP + Phosphoenolpyruvate

COFACTOR CO2
COMMENT UTP, GTP, CTP, ITP and dATP can also act as donors. Also
phosphorylates hydroxylamine and fluoride in the presence of CO2.
